Gambian President Condemns Homosexuality



The President of Gambia, His Excellency Sheikh Professor Alhaji Dr. Yahya Abdul-Azziz Jemus Junkung Jammeh, is the latest African statesman to indulge in what is now almost a Presidential right of passage: gay bashing in the name of religion. Jammeh worries that the emergence of l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ender and intersex (LGBTI) people in Gambia may be the warning sign of an emerging democracy, the Daily Observer reports.

The Gambian leader declared a zero tolerance for homosexuals in The Gambia, adding that any act that violates the laws of the land will not be compromised. Describing homosexuality as ungodly and one that will not be tolerated in The Gambia, President Jammeh said that even pigs among other animals, do not involve in homosexuality. So why are the human beings who are not created from evolution of animal doing it? We will live according to what Allah has said.

We are descendants of Adam and Eve and here in The Gambia, it is only a husband and a wife (man and woman) and nothing else. I will rather die but I will not allow homosexuals or lesbians in this country. If that is what those so-called democracy advocators want, I will not allow it here, he stated, and attributed the disastrous change of climate as a punishment from Allah because of those ungodly acts.
